COMPOSITE GLASS CLOTH-CELLULOSE FIBER EPOXY RESIN LAMINATE ABSTRACT OF THE DISCLOSURE Unclad and metal clad laminates are constructed by sandwiching a resin impregnated core of paper between epoxy resin impregnated woven glass fabric sheets. The paper is a water laid sheet of cellulose fibers, preferably wood cellulose or cotton linter fibers having an average length from about 0.5 to 5 mm. The laminates are used as substrates for printed circuits and printed circuit modules.
